The addition of the Courtyard by Marriott hotel at the Grandview Yard provides the lodging capacity needed to properly support the Grand Event Center, restaurants and other mixed uses within the development.  Courtyard provides 134 guestrooms, common spaces, conference rooms and an interior swimming pool.

As other national chains, Marriott brought its own branding requirements.  These requirements often did not align with the architectural vision of the Grandview Yard.  Acock was responsible for developing an architectural expression that satisfied both of its clients. Pleasant outcomes from the customization include suites with walk out balconies that have views to the Columbus downtown skyline.

The building’s exterior consists of a mix of horizontal metal siding and handmoulded brick veneer. A true 360-degree building, there is no rear façade to the building to hide services. The entry is opposite to Goodale Blvd, the primary road at the south boundary of the Yard development.

Courtyard by Marriott creates its namesake by developing an exterior court between the hotel and the adjacent Grand Event Center.  This adjacency has proved to be mutually beneficial and very desirable for customers considering weddings and special events.
